Preparation Time
Before diving into the cooking time, it’s essential to note that the preparation time for hot pockets can vary depending on the recipe and your experience in the kitchen. On average, it takes about 10-15 minutes to prepare the filling and assemble the hot pockets. This includes preparing the ingredients, filling the dough, and sealing the edges.
Cooking Time
Once your hot pockets are assembled, the cooking time can range from 15 to 25 minutes. Here are some factors that can influence the cooking time:
1. Oven Temperature: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) for the best results. If your oven runs a bit cool, you may need to adjust the cooking time accordingly.
2. Size of Hot Pockets: Larger hot pockets will take longer to cook than smaller ones. Keep this in mind when estimating the cooking time.
3. Recipe Variation: Different recipes may call for variations in ingredients and cooking methods, which can affect the overall cooking time.
How to Check Doneness
To ensure your hot pockets are cooked to perfection, it’s essential to check for doneness. Here are a few tips:
1. Color: The edges and top of the hot pockets should be golden brown.
2. Sound: Gently tap the bottom of a hot pocket. If it sounds hollow, it’s likely done. If it still sounds doughy, it may need a few more minutes.
3. Temperature: Use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ature. The filling should reach at least 165°F (74°C) for safe consumption.
Additional Tips
– Preheating the oven is crucial for even cooking. Make sure your oven is at the correct temperature before placing the hot pockets inside.
– Don’t overcrowd the oven. If you have multiple hot pockets, cook them in batches to avoid a longer cooking time.
– If you’re using a toaster oven, adjust the cooking time accordingly, as toaster ovens may have different heat distribution.
